Did Summer Spellman (Harriet Bibby) kill Theo Silverton (James Cartwright) in Coronation Street?

As it stands, a mountain of evidence is stacked against her – and George Shuttleworth (Tony Maudsley) is convinced that she was responsible for his death.
Last month, following wedding celebrations on the cobbles, Betsy Swain (Sydney Martin) found his body in the corner shop backyard. Attentions initially turned to George, who was noticeably absent for much of the evening, and then to his partner Christina Boyd (Amy Robbins).
DC Kit Green’s (Jacob Roberts) theory is that Gary Windass (Mikey North) is responsible, though his alibi has been backed up by wife Maria Connor (Samia Longchambon).
Earlier this week, George was startled to find a very incriminating page of Summer’s journal, that detailed her desire to aim a gun at Theo’s head. Summer was already looking visibly unnerved whenever the murder investigation was mentioned, and had even decided to move to America to escape the madness.
She was furious to find George and Christina rifling through her diary, and proceeded to burn the evidence in the back yard.

George noted that this could’ve been seen as evidence, and that it intensified what could be perceived as a guilty demeanour.
Little did they realise, over at the police station, attentions were already beginning to turn towards her. While flicking through her wedding photos with Kit, Lisa Connor-Swain (Vicky Myers) clocked a photo of Summer chatting to two of the partygoers – wearing the brooch that had been found on the floor of Theo’s flat.
In today’s episode, Summer was whisked into the station and interviewed under caution.
She presented the photo of her wearing the brooch, and questioned how it would make its way across the road and upstairs into the scene of the crime.
Summer denied all knowledge, saying that it must’ve fallen off her while she was leaving the wedding party and that Theo had picked it up. Connor-Swain looked unconvinced by her reasoning, but allowed her to leave.
Upon returning to the cobbles, Todd Grimshaw (Gareth Pierce) tore strips off the copper for bringing Summer in, insisting that she had nothing to do with it. He also suspected that George had reported her, though this wasn’t the case.

He whole-heartedly apologised for going through her belongings, but when she explained about the brooch, his suspicions were aroused once again.
George asked Summer whether she went to the flat that night, though she lied through her teeth and said that she hadn’t. A telling flashback took us back to the fateful evening, as George spotted Summer rushing off from the direction of the corner shop.
Why is Summer lying, and did she kill Theo?
